Cristhian,
 
Has sacado el PRTSQLINF despu�s de compilar el programa � despu�s de ejecutarlo?
 
Realmente al compilarlo, la informaci�n que te puede dar el sistema nos es ni mucho 
menos la mejor. 
Si lo has ejecutado antes, pruena ha hacerlo y sacar la informaci�n de PRTSQLINF de 
nuevo.
 
De todas formas, lo mejor es que tu mismo lo monitorices, bien con STRDBG, bien con 
STRDBMON, y saques tiempos de respuesta.
 
Un saludo, Jos�.

-----Original Message-----
From: Cristhian Nu�ez [mailto:[EMAIL PROTECTED]]
Sent: s�bado 15 de febrero de 2003 19:44
To: [EMAIL PROTECTED]
Subject: Mejorar rendimiento de sentencia SQL


Hola Foro:
 
Ejecute el comando PRTSQLINF sobre un programa y en el listado de spool encontre que 
dos sentencias SQL que insertan datos tenian tiempos de ejecucion diferentes.
Me gustaria saber por que? y como puede mejorar el rendimiento. 
 
Listado:
 
 INSERT INTO KARDEX_D ( KARDEX , SECUENCIA , ARTICULO , CANTIDAD ,      
VALOR_UNIT_MN , VALOR_UNIT_ME , VALOR_TOT_MN , VALOR_TOT_ME , FECHA )   VALUES (: H , 
: H , : H , : H , 0 , 0 , 0 , 0 , : H )                                
   SQL4021  La �ltima vez que se salv� el plan de acceso fue el 15/02/03 a las  
   SQL4020  El tiempo de ejecuci�n de consulta calculado es de 14 segundos.
   SQL4010  V�a de acceso en secuencia de llegada para archivo 1.               

 INSERT INTO GUIA_D ( GUIA , SECUENCIA , ARTICULO , DESCRIPCION , CANTIDAD)  VALUES ( 
: H , : H , : H , : H , : H )                   
   SQL4021  La �ltima vez que se salv� el plan de acceso fue el 14/02/03 a las  
   SQL4020  El tiempo de ejecuci�n de consulta calculado es de 1 segundos.      
   SQL4010  V�a de acceso en secuencia de llegada para archivo 1.               
 

Saludos y Gracias


_____________________________________________________
Forum.HELP400 es un servicio m�s de NEWS/400.
� Publicaciones Help400, S.L. - Todos los derechos reservados
http://www.help400.es
_____________________________________________________

Para darte de baja, env�a el mensaje resultante de pulsar
mailto:[EMAIL PROTECTED]?body=LEAVE

Responder a